Bug 1430183 - [RFE] Add a command similar to spacewalk-data-fsck for Satellite 6.
Summary: [RFE] Add a command similar to spacewalk-data-fsck for Satellite 6.
Keywords:
Status: CLOSED WONTFIX
Alias: None
Product: Red Hat Satellite
Classification: Red Hat
Component: Infrastructure
Version: 6.2.7
Hardware: Unspecified
OS: Unspecified
low
low
Target Milestone: Unspecified
Assignee: satellite6-bugs
QA Contact: Katello QA List
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2017-03-08 01:34 UTC by Paul Dudley
Modified: 2019-08-12 16:31 UTC (History)
3 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2018-09-04 19:04:37 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)

Description Paul Dudley 2017-03-08 01:34:50 UTC
In cases of verifying the filesystem and db of Satellite 6 it may be useful to have a command similar to spacewalk-data-fsck - or at least a series of commands that perform similar functions.

For reference:
[root@sat5 ~]# spacewalk-data-fsck --help
Usage: spacewalk-data-fsck [options]

Options:
  -v, --verbose        Increase verbosity
  -S, --no-size        Don't check package size
  -C, --no-checksum    Don't check package checksum
  -O, --no-nevrao      Don't check package name, epoch, version, release,
                       arch, org
  -d, --db-only        Check only if packages from database are present on
                       filesystem
  -f, --fs-only        Check only if packages from filesystem are in the
                       database
  -r, --remove         Automaticaly remove packages from filesystem not
                       present in database
  -F, --fix-file-path  Restores file paths, try this when you have NEVRAO
                       mismatches. Do not run this command with another
                       commands
  -h, --help           show this help message and exit

Comment 1 Stephen Benjamin 2017-03-13 15:29:12 UTC
I think some subset of the functionality is in foreman-rake katello:clean_backend_objects and the cronjobs in /etc/cron.weekly/, like katello-clean-empty-puppet-environments and katello-remove-orphans.

There's an effort upstream to consolidate all of these kinds of things into foreman-maintain.  

@Ivan, Is there already an open BZ that might cover this 
RFE?

Comment 2 Ivan Necas 2017-03-13 19:35:35 UTC
Not that I'm aware of

Comment 3 Bryan Kearney 2018-09-04 18:54:46 UTC
Thank you for your interest in Satellite 6. We have evaluated this request, and we do not expect this to be implemented in the product in the foreseeable future. We are therefore closing this out as WONTFIX. If you have any concerns about this, please feel free to contact Rich Jerrido or Bryan Kearney. Thank you.

Comment 4 Bryan Kearney 2018-09-04 19:04:37 UTC
Thank you for your interest in Satellite 6. We have evaluated this request, and we do not expect this to be implemented in the product in the foreseeable future. We are therefore closing this out as WONTFIX. If you have any concerns about this, please feel free to contact Rich Jerrido or Bryan Kearney. Thank you.


Note You need to log in before you can comment on or make changes to this bug.